excel中怎么注音

excel中怎么注音

在Excel中为文本添加注音的方法包括:使用拼音指南、手动插入拼音、利用VBA宏。以下将详细介绍如何在Excel中使用拼音指南添加注音。拼音指南是Excel自带的一项功能,可以为中文字符添加拼音注音,方便用户进行学习和理解。

一、使用拼音指南

1. 拼音指南的基础操作

拼音指南是Excel自带的一个功能,主要用于为中文字符添加拼音注音。以下是具体步骤:

  1. 选择文本:首先,选中需要添加注音的单元格。
  2. 开启拼音指南:在Excel菜单栏中,点击“开始”选项卡,然后在字体区域找到“拼音指南”按钮,点击它即可。
  3. 设置拼音格式:在弹出的拼音指南对话框中,可以设置拼音的字体、字号、对齐方式等。

2. 调整拼音显示位置

拼音指南默认会将拼音注音显示在文本的上方,但用户可以根据需要调整拼音的位置。具体步骤如下:

  1. 选择包含拼音的单元格:再次选中已经添加拼音注音的单元格。
  2. 调整拼音位置:在拼音指南对话框中,可以选择拼音显示在上方、下方、左侧或右侧。

二、手动插入拼音

1. 使用Unicode字符

如果拼音指南无法满足需求,用户还可以手动插入拼音。这种方法比较适用于少量文本的注音。

  1. 查找Unicode字符:在网上查找拼音的Unicode字符,例如,“ā”对应的Unicode是U+0101。
  2. 插入Unicode字符:在Excel中,按住“Alt”键,然后在小键盘上输入Unicode字符的十进制代码。例如,要插入“ā”,可以按住“Alt”键,然后输入“0257”。

2. 利用公式添加拼音

Excel提供了强大的公式功能,可以利用公式来实现拼音注音。以下是一个简单的示例:

  1. 准备拼音数据:在Excel的一个区域内输入拼音数据,例如,将汉字和对应的拼音分别输入A列和B列。
  2. 使用VLOOKUP函数:在需要显示拼音的单元格中,使用VLOOKUP函数查找拼音数据。例如,=VLOOKUP(A1, B:C, 2, FALSE)

三、利用VBA宏

1. 编写VBA代码

对于大量文本的注音,手动操作可能比较繁琐。此时,可以利用Excel的VBA宏来自动添加拼音。以下是一个简单的VBA示例:

Sub AddPinyin()

Dim rng As Range

Dim cell As Range

Dim pinyin As String

Set rng = Selection

For Each cell In rng

pinyin = GetPinyin(cell.Value)

cell.Value = cell.Value & " (" & pinyin & ")"

Next cell

End Sub

Function GetPinyin(text As String) As String

' 此处需要根据具体需求编写拼音转换逻辑

GetPinyin = "pinyin"

End Function

2. 运行VBA宏

  1. 打开VBA编辑器:按“Alt + F11”打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,点击“插入”菜单,然后选择“模块”。
  3. 粘贴代码:将上述代码粘贴到新建的模块中。
  4. 运行宏:关闭VBA编辑器,返回Excel,按“Alt + F8”打开宏对话框,选择刚才编写的宏,然后点击“运行”。

四、总结

在Excel中为文本添加注音的方法有很多,用户可以根据具体需求选择合适的方法。使用拼音指南是最简单的方法,手动插入拼音适用于少量文本,利用VBA宏则适合大量文本的批量处理。每种方法都有其优缺点,用户可以根据实际情况进行选择。

相关问答FAQs:

1. 在Excel中如何实现汉字注音?

在Excel中,实现汉字注音可以使用“文本转语音”功能。首先,选中需要注音的汉字,然后在Excel的“插入”选项卡中找到“语音”组,在“文本转语音”中选择“开始朗读”。Excel会自动为选中的汉字添加注音,并通过语音播放出来。

2. 如何在Excel中实现汉字的拼音显示?

要在Excel中实现汉字的拼音显示,可以使用Excel的内置函数“拼音函数”。首先,在需要显示拼音的单元格中输入拼音函数,如“=拼音(A1)”,其中A1是包含汉字的单元格。按下回车键后,Excel会自动将汉字转换为对应的拼音,并显示在该单元格中。

3. Excel中是否有快速注音的功能?

是的,Excel提供了一个快速注音的功能,可以通过使用宏实现。首先,打开Excel并按下“Alt + F11”键,打开Visual Basic for Applications(VBA)编辑器。然后,在VBA编辑器中创建一个新的模块,将以下代码复制粘贴到模块中:

Sub AddPhoneticGuide()
    Dim rng As Range
    For Each rng In Selection
        rng.Phonetic.Text = rng.Value
    Next rng
End Sub

保存并关闭VBA编辑器。现在,选中需要注音的汉字,然后按下“Alt + F8”键,选择“AddPhoneticGuide”宏并点击“运行”。Excel会自动为选中的汉字添加注音。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4373111

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部